Well...it finally happened to me. I put a post up here a few days ago looking for a nice scope to accompany my new rifle. I was approached (through text) by a guy who supposedly had a Leupold scope he no longer needed. I had already purchased a new scope by the time he contacted me but was interested in what he had.

Through conversation, I agreed to buy his scope for $150 shipped. He requested a Paypal payment (using the Family and Friends method...last time that will happen! mad) and I sent the money to him.

Fast forward one day and he is prepping it for shipping. He texts me saying he will ship as soon as he has enough money to do so. Confused, I responded saying he agreed to ship it for the total sent. He responded that he had already used the money to pay his "sick daughter's medical bills" and that he only had $12 left. He would be happy to ship if I would send an additional $20 (because supposedly shipping costs $32).

I respectfully declined and asked for a full refund after he went back on his word on our deal. He told me he would refund me the $150 if he could find some money. He got me.

I called my bank to put a stop payment on that and was told because it was an ACH payment, they couldn't. I contacted Paypal to file a dispute but because I "authorized it" and used F&F, they declined and denied my dispute.

I sent a request in Paypal to this person requesting the $150 and he declined it right away. I text him and he is no longer answering me back.

I CANNOT imagine doing this to ANYONE and using the awful excuse of having a sick child. There are terrible people in this world. I have had a ton of great dealings on here (and elsewhere) and haven't had an ounce of trouble sending money and buying things sight unseen. I guess it was finally my turn and realize I was a bit too trusting.

I am not sure if that person is lurking around on here or on the Texas Bowhunters. I put an ad on each site and he texted me from one of them.

I posted this up a few months ago about the WTB adds getting fraud activity. If you do business via PayPal, the "Friends and Family" method is not a protected purchase with no recourse on the buyers end. I had 2 separate contacts. Both said they had the item I was looking for, and it was at a price that was very attractive. Both requested payment via PayPal through Friends and Family. I requested it go through my business CC or through the traditional method on PayPal, and I will pay the additional fees. Once I requested this, I didn't here back from either contact, except for a simple No from one (after multiple texts).

The name, phone number, and info you have will most likely be fake anyway.

Unfortunately, you got took! May be SOL as previously stated but this is a criminal offense. The amount that you were taken for keeps it as a Misdemeanor but I suggest you contact either you local PD or SO (depending on your location). I had to work way too many of these types cases. One lady was taken for about 15,000 and she has yet to receive the Mercedes that she was told she won. Never could locate the [censored] that committed any of them. Some were over the wire and others were from spoofed phones. The Feds were helpful but told me that some were coming from Canada and some from Jamaica.
I have done several transactions with THF members but all have either been by check or money order. I just don't do Pay Pal and my bank does not recognize Venmo. Sorry that this happened to you but there are just a bunch of scumbags out there that have no sense of right and wrong.

Originally Posted by Gumbeaux
Paying through the goods and services function on PayPal probably would have cost you an extra $3-4 and you could have gotten the $150 back. It's cheap insurance.


I am not so sure about that. PayPal explicitly prohibits using their service for anything gun related. I don’t think you could make a successful claim if the purchase was something prohibited. I do quite a bit of buying and selling and I am in Lubbock so 99% of it involves shipping and I use cash app, Venmo, or pay pal friends and family. I have never had an issue. I refuse to use the goods and services because for one I don’t believe they will cover you if it is a prohibited item and second they will 1099 you at the end of the year for the goods and services amount. Friends and family does not count towards the 1099 total.

I always look for an established and active user name.
